Amazon RoboticsVP Brad Porter took to the stage to showcase a pair of fresh robotics designed to bustle automation within the firm’s success centers. Xanthus represents a foremost redesign of then firm’s significant robots, which were core to its technique since its 2012 acquisition of Kiva Programs.

Modularity is the significant here, as with opponents take care of Win. The pressure foundation gives the in-dwelling robotics personnel the flexibility to fabricate personalized robotics for substitute warehouse takes, all with the identical licensed based mostly fully machine. Amazon says this would be showcasing about a of the decisions this week at the build in Vegas, including the Xanthus Sort Bot and Xanthus Tote Mover.

Extra data on these later, absolute self assurance, nonetheless all appear to be centered on substitute components of the identical process: piquant deliveries spherical the success center. Earlier within the year, the firm acknowledged that it’s already deployed north of 100,000 robotic systems in bigger than 25 success centers across the U.S., a key portion of the retail giants push toward even faster transport cases. Nowadays, it’s centered on single day transport for many programs.

This day, the firm says it’s expanded to 200,000 robotic pressure robots internationally. That resolve contains every in-dwelling and third-occasion systems.

Also fresh is the Pegasus machine. The robotic will feature in a the same skill because the Kiva robotic drives, which currently navigate spherical a fenced in “grid,” carrying huge shelving pods. This robotic, on the substitute hand, is is designed to type and pass particular individual programs. The machine has already been deployed 800 Pegasus items in about a of Amazon’s success centers.

The firm believes the single equipment transport machine will additional effectivity within the warehouse.

“We’re continuously trying out and trialing fresh solutions and robotics that give a steal to the safety, quality, transport go and overall effectivity of our operations,” a spokesperson for the firm stated in an announcement issued at the match. “Our fresh Pegasus pressure items support to cleave type errors, cleave damage, and go up transport cases. The Xanthus household of drives brings an modern agree with, enabling engineers to fabricate a portfolio of operational solutions, all off the identical hardware ghastly throughout the addition of fresh functional attachments. We imagine that including robotics and fresh applied sciences to our operations community will continue toughen the affiliate and buyer ride.”
